On Thu, Nov 18, 2010 at 08:05:56PM +0000, Grant Edwards wrote:
> On 2010-11-18, Michael Haardt <michael@moria.de> wrote:
> >> > I miss a way to disable the transmit FIFO.
> >>
> >> From userspace or from within a kernel driver?
> >
> > From userspace.
> 
> $ man setserial

Specifically, if you use setserial to configure a serial port so that
its UART is a 16450, it will force the transmit FIFO to be unused.
